ISLAMABAD: Foreign Minister Shah Mahmood Qureshi has emphasised the need for collective endeavours to combat the scourge of rising Islamophobia.

According to a statement of the Foreign Office, Foreign Minister Shah Mahmood Qureshi had a telephone conversation with OIC Secretary General Dr Yousef A Al-Othaimeen, Thursday, and discussed Islamophobia and the situation in the Indian Illegally Occupied Jammu and Kashmir (IIOJK) with him.

It added that the two sides discussed a wide range of issues related to the Muslim Ummah.

The foreign minister highlighted that, as a founding member of the Organization, Pakistan attached utmost importance to the OIC and the issues of concern to the Muslim world.

Qureshi noted the rise in incidents of Islamophobia and hate speech against Muslims, including desecration of the holy Quran and reprinting of caricatures of the holy Prophet (PBUH), which had seriously hurt the sentiments of the Muslims around the world.

The foreign minister highlighted the importance of collective endeavours to combat the scourge of Islamophobia.

He also apprised the OIC secretary general of the worsening human rights and humanitarian situation in the IIOJK since India’s illegal and unilateral actions of 5 August 2019.

He highlighted that India had promulgated new domicile rules and introduced amendments in landownership laws to alter the demographic structure of the occupied territory, which was a clear violation of the relevant UN and OIC resolutions, and the international law.

The foreign minister stated that besides continued lockdown, military siege and communication blackout for over one year, occupation forces had intensified repression of the Kashmiri population through extra-judicial killings in fake “encounters” and “collective punishment” for Kashmiri communities and neighbourhoods.

He also appreciated the OIC’s consistent support on the Jammu and Kashmir dispute.
